Doppler Ultrasound
A Doppler ultrasound is an essential tool for accurate venous and vascular medicine diagnosis. It allows for an in-depth evaluation of veins, arteries, and blood flow.
Sclerotherapy
Sclerotherapy involves closing a varicose vein by injecting a solution that scleroses its walls. This treatment, sometimes cosmetic, reduces the appearance of varicose veins under the skin. Injections are performed using liquid or foam, and patients see visible improvements after the first session.
Outpatient phlebectomy
A technique to remove surface veins that are too large for sclerotherapy, aiming to improve the appearance and comfort of the lower limbs.
Saphenous Vein Ablation by Radiofrequency
An endovenous treatment performed under local anesthesia, with no work stoppage, allowing for a quick return to daily activities.
Services OfferedAtherosclerotic Vascular Diseases
Carotid Stenosis Screening and Diagnosis
Narrowing of the carotid artery can lead to cerebrovascular accidents (CVA), commonly known as stroke. Often asymptomatic, it must be detected through a physical examination and diagnosed using ultrasound.
Abdominal Aortic Aneurysm Screening and Diagnosis
Localized enlargement or dilation of at least 150% of the abdominal aorta’s diameter. Sometimes discovered during abdominal palpation, an abdominal ultrasound can confirm the diagnosis and monitor the condition.
Peripheral Arterial Disease Diagnosis
Peripheral arterial disease is a blockage of the arteries carrying oxygenated blood from the heart to the legs. It may cause leg pain or fatigue following exertion. Peripheral arterial disease can be diagnosed at the clinic using an arterial Doppler ultrasound.
